I was searching those historic buildings like Tarpon inn (originally a Civil War barracks), old houses at the Lighthouse, how they survived hurricanes in the past - what I learned was that they didn't -
- the 1919 Hurricane scalped Tarpon, Texas (Port A).
They just decided on some of the historic buildings to build them over the same way they were before.
